Transaction 2ca8c162826fa8837cf69e95586751ea07ccbd100fc6c7e2a98a4446da40f63d

3 Input
2 Outputs
  • 2ca8c162826fa8837cf69e95586751ea07ccbd100fc6c7e2a98a4446da40f63d:0
  • value  3767313
    address  17cUgMj3kRBWcByyDcpkorKRrDZdGUFAfC
  • 2ca8c162826fa8837cf69e95586751ea07ccbd100fc6c7e2a98a4446da40f63d:1
  • value  8378718
    address  3EWheuzgMfkEuRWMDhZDreuCwrVDBf9Uj3